Replacing a ro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the primary driver, along with the specific materials you select—as premium shingles or metal options carry higher price points than standard asphalt. We also look at the complexity of your roof’s architecture, such as steep pitches or multiple chimneys, which require extra labor and safety gear. Additionally, the condition of the wood decking underneath your old shingles can add costs if repairs are needed once we strip the old layers.
Choosing a metal roof color is about balancing aesthetics with heat reflection. Lighter shades often help deflect sunlight, which can keep your home cooler in hot climates. Darker tones provide a bold look but might absorb more heat. Beyond appearance, consider how the finish interacts with your local neighborhood style. Since metal roofs last a long time, pick a color you will be happy with for many years. We can discuss options that fit your home’s specific design during our consultation.
Summer offers long, dry days that are ideal for efficient roofing work. High temperatures can be physically demanding for crews, so we often start early to finish before the peak heat of the afternoon. This schedule helps maintain the integrity of your materials and ensures a high-quality finish for your new roof installation.

Asphalt shingle roofs are a common choice in Colorado Springs, offering a balance of cost and protection. Their lifespan typically ranges from 15 to 30 years, depending on quality and installation. Rubber roofing can be a durable and cost-effective option for low-slope or flat roofs in Colorado Springs. It offers excellent waterproofing and is resistant to temperature fluctuations. A standing seam roof offers a clean, modern look and exceptional durability, making it ideal for Colorado Springs' climate. Its concealed fasteners provide superior weather resistance.
